Summary

NIL — the Networked Intent Layer — is a settlement architecture that separates the expression of economic intent from the physical movement of capital. Where conventional payment infrastructure treats capital transmission as the mechanism of settlement itself, NIL treats it as one possible resolution strategy among several, to be invoked only when necessary.

A payment instruction is compiled into an Obligation Object (Ω): a tracked, transferable representation of an unresolved economic commitment. Obligations are routed to Settlement Domains — bounded liquidity environments — where local Human Settlement Cells can satisfy recipients using liquidity already present, independent of the originating domain's capital position.

Obligations that remain unresolved are periodically evaluated as a directed graph. Where cyclic structure exists — A owes B, B owes C, C owes A — the network cancels the overlapping portion algebraically. Only the residual imbalance, if any, requires external capital displacement.

Core Claim

Gross payment volume is an implementation detail of how a payment network chooses to resolve obligations. It is not a property of the underlying economic activity. NIL is built around the position that most gross volume in a sufficiently dense network is redundant, and that a protocol which tracks obligations explicitly can eliminate the redundant portion before capital ever moves.

Scope of This Documentation

This documentation describes NIL-0, the current protocol draft. It is organized into six sections: protocol model, core object definitions, routing, clearing, finality, and security. A companion specification (24 · NIL-0 Specification) collects the normative requirements referenced throughout.

All network activity, obligations, domains, and metrics referenced in this documentation and in the accompanying interface are synthetic and simulated for illustrative purposes.
